Transaction ddf4e8e4e49b875717518d34c28cfdb1842b0cc98fb1970e2e1f55c7857aa95c

1 Input
2 Outputs
  • ddf4e8e4e49b875717518d34c28cfdb1842b0cc98fb1970e2e1f55c7857aa95c:0
  • value  580144
    address  3E7sB6Rw4FBeAXHHojZDSyvdzp5Ddn9Kq9
  • ddf4e8e4e49b875717518d34c28cfdb1842b0cc98fb1970e2e1f55c7857aa95c:1
  • value  3830213
    address  1EMgeWcaua5s1HL36oHzdJS7JD2dnoLv2o